Question 516282: Find two numbers whose difference is 5 and the difference of their squares is 65

x - y = 5
x^2 - y^2 = 65
x = 5 + y


using the given:
x = 5 + y
square both sides
x^2 = 25 + 10y + y^2
x^2 = 65 + y^2
65 + y^2 = 25 +10y +y^2


65 = 25 + 10y
40 = 10y
4 = y
y = 4


x - y = 5
x - (4) = 5
x = 9


check, does 9^2 - 4^2 = 65?
yes, 81 - 16 = 65
